Of course, there is Ami Tavory's work that is now in libstdc++ and 
included as part of the libstdc++ performance testsuite that attempts to 
qualify this....

See "Tree-Like-Based Containers"
http://gcc.gnu.org/onlinedocs/libstdc++/ext/pb_ds/assoc_performance_tests.html

 From this, we see that text insert/text find are good with rb tree but 
text find/locality not so good with rb tree.

Thus, our meta-point that these data structures need more 
configurability... it was heartening to see the boost SOC tree work take 
a look at this research.
